Günlük Ulaşımda Bireysel Davranış Değişiminin Karbon Ayak İzi Üzerindeki Etkisi: Iğdır Örneğinde Bisiklet Kullanımına İlişkin Uygulamalı Bir Çalışma

Abstract

Bu çalışma, bireysel ulaşım tercihlerindeki davranışsal değişimlerin karbon ayak izi üzerindeki etkisini öz-gözlemsel bir vaka analizi aracılığıyla sunmaktadır. Teorik olarak, Planlı Davranış Teorisi ve Değer–İnanç–Norm Kuramı çerçevesinde bireysel eylemin motivasyonel temelleri açıklanmaktadır. Araştırma, Türkiye’nin Iğdır ilinde yaşayan bir kamu çalışanının yaklaşık iki ay boyunca özel araç kullanımını bırakarak bisiklete geçişini ele almakta ve bu geçişi nicel verilerle destekleyerek çevresel, ekonomik, hava kirliliği ve sağlık açısından analiz etmektedir. Katılımcının haftalık 145,52 km’lik bisiklet kullanımı sonucunda yaklaşık 21,43 kg CO₂e salımı engellenmiş ve 7,999 litre yakıt tasarrufu sağlanmıştır. Ayrıca fiziksel aktivite düzeyi Dünya Sağlık Örgütü standartlarına uygun hâle gelmiştir. Bu bağlamda çalışma, bireysel düzeydeki düşük karbonlu ulaşım uygulamalarının kolektif iklim hedeflerine katkı potansiyelini vurgularken, yerel yönetimlerin eksikliklerine dikkat çekmekte ve politika önerileri sunmaktadır.

The Impact of Individual Behavioural Change in Daily Transportation on Carbon Footprint: An Applied Study on Bicycle Use in the Case of Iğdır

Abstract

This study presents the impact of behavioural changes in individual transportation preferences on the carbon footprint through a self-observational case study. From a theoretical perspective, the motivational underpinnings of individual action are explained within the framework of the Theory of Planned Behaviour and the Value–Belief–Norm Theory. The study focuses on a public employee living in Iğdır Province, Türkiye, who, over a period of approximately two months, switched from private cars to bicycles. This transition is analysed using quantitative data regarding environmental, economic, air pollution, and health aspects. As a result, the participant's weekly cycling distance of 145.52 km led to the prevention of approximately 21.43 kg of CO₂e emissions and the saving of 7,999 litres of fuel. Moreover, their physical activity level met World Health Organization standards. Overall, the study highlights the potential for low-carbon transportation practices at the individual level to contribute to collective climate goals, while also emphasizing the shortcomings of local governments and providing policy recommendations.
